Nelson Email Organiser (NEO) is a companion tool for Microsoft Outlook 97/98/2000/2002 that provides superior organisational facilities for your email.
NEO can be used instead of Outlook, but keeping all key Outlook features accessible, including email sending/receiving/forwarding, Contacts and Journal.
Downloaded emails are automatically sorted into folders. New emails are placed in the Active Mail folder, but are also organised into other folders by date, ie Today, Yesterday, This Week and Last Week.
There is also a To Do folder, into which you can manually move messages that require action.
A tabbed menu lets you view your emails in other ways too. Click the Status tab to view messages in Active, Kept, Tagged and Unread groups. "Tagging" an email simply highlights it, while "Keeping" an email prevents it from being deleted until the action is undone.
A powerful search tool indexes every word of every email for precise, useful searching.
All emails remain stored in Outlook, with NEO simply creating multiple references to them. Delete email in NEO and it remains in Outlook (and vice versa) until the programs are synchronised.
